Target Industries & Applications
Aerospace & Defense
- Components: Structural frames, brackets, housings, turbine components, fittings
- Materials: Aluminum (2024, 7075), titanium, Inconel, high-strength steels
- Standards: AS9100, NADCAP (machining), MIL specifications, customer-specific
- Critical Requirements: Fatigue resistance, weight optimization, documentation, traceability
Medical & Life Sciences
- Components: Surgical instruments, implantable devices, diagnostic equipment, prosthetics
- Materials: 316L stainless, titanium (Grade 5, 23), PEEK, cobalt-chrome
- Requirements: Biocompatibility, cleanroom manufacturing, sterilization compatibility
- Regulations: FDA compliance, ISO 13485, USP Class VI testing where applicable
Automotive & Motorsports
- Components: Engine parts, transmission housings, suspension components, brackets
- Materials: Aluminum, various steels, brass, magnesium (racing)
- Production Volumes: Prototype to high-volume (10,000+ parts)
- Special Capabilities: JIT delivery, kanban systems, production line support
Electronics & Semiconductor
- Components: Enclosures, heat sinks, wafer handling, test fixtures, connector bodies
- Materials: Aluminum, copper, engineering plastics, composites
- Precision Requirements: Often ±0.005mm or better, micron-level flatness
- Cleanliness: ESD-safe materials, particulate control, specialized cleaning
Industrial Machinery & Automation
- Components: Machine frames, brackets, guides, robotic components, fixture
- Materials: Carbon steel, aluminum, stainless, cast iron
- Requirements: Wear resistance, dimensional stability, rigidity
- Capabilities: Large part machining, weldment preparation, assembly interfaces

Lead Time Guidelines
| Production Type | Standard Lead Time | Expedited Options | Factors Affecting Lead Time |
|---|---|---|---|
| Prototype (1-10 pcs) | 5-15 business days | 3-5 days (+30-50%) | Material availability, complexity, fixturing |
| Low Volume (10-100 pcs) | 10-25 business days | 5-10 days (+25-40%) | Tooling requirements, secondary operations |
| Medium Volume (100-1,000 pcs) | 3-5 weeks | 2-3 weeks (+20-35%) | Production scheduling, capacity |
| High Volume (1,000+ pcs) | 6-12 weeks | 4-8 weeks (+15-30%) | Material procurement, dedicated production runs |
| Large Parts (>1m dimension) | 4-10 weeks | 3-6 weeks (+25-50%) | Special handling, machine availability |
Packaging, Shipping & Logistics
Packaging Solutions
- Standard Packaging: Poly bags with desiccant in partitioned cartons
- ESD-Sensitive: Antistatic bags, conductive foam, static-dissipative containers
- Cleanroom Packaging: Double-bagged, cleanroom compatible materials
- VCI Protection: Volatile corrosion inhibitor papers/films for ferrous metals
- Custom Fixturing: CNC-machured foam inserts, custom racks, reusable containers
- International Shipping: Export-rated crates, climate-controlled options available
